Blitz: The League Joins Greatest Hits
Midway's football game gets new pricing on Xbox and PS2.
Date: Thursday, June 08, 2006
Author: James 'Prophet' Fudge

Midway Games today announced that its hard-hitting, lifestyle-driven football videogame, Blitz: The League has reached Greatest Hits status for the PlayStation 2 and Platinum Hits status for the Xbox. Blitz: The League will be re-distributed nationwide with new packaging at a suggested U.S. retail price of $19.99 for both platforms as a result. Blitz: The League is also in development for the XBOX 360 and the PSP and is expected to ship in Fall 2006.
